President Joko “Jokowi” Widodo Friday (03/01) visited the Nusantara Capital (IKN) Command Center and the national public television network TVRI’s mini studio located in the IKN area, East Kalimantan province.

The Nusantara Command Center is designed to optimize the development of the Nusantara Capital City as well as to ensure integration and coordination. It is also one of the main infrastructures supporting the Nusantara smart city.

The phase 1 Command Center has the main function of monitoring the construction of the Nusantara Capital equipped with CCTV-based surveillance and monitoring technology, visual-based drone monitoring, and digital service integration.

During the visit to the mini studio, President Director of TVRI Imam Brotoseno said that in compliance with the regulation, TVRI must present in the capital city of the country.

For the record, Government Regulation Number 11 of 2005 on the Organization of Public Broadcasting Institutions states that RRI and TVRI are located in the capital city of the Republic of Indonesia and their branches are located in the regions.

“It means that TVRI must reside in the Nusantara, the new capital of the country in the near future,” he said.

Furthermore, Imam explained that TVRI’s presence in IKN is a commitment from TVRI to support the development of IKN, as well as disseminate on IKN and provide information both domestic and abroad through TVRI World.

“TVRI World is specifically designed for global audiences abroad and broadcasts in English. There are also investment opportunities mentioned, inviting investors to visit IKN,” he said. (BPMI of Presidential Secretariat/UN) (FI/LW)
